Abstract
Disposición para la captación de la energía solar aplicable a la aclimatación de todo tipo de edificios, ya sean públicos o naves industriales, que se caracteriza porque está constituida básicamente por módulos formados por dos o más placas huecas de sección variable y material ligero, colocadas paralelamente entre sí, por cuyo interior circula un fluido dotado de propiedades químicas que favorecen la captación de energía solar, yendo introducidos dichas placas por sus extremos respectivos en las bocas de sendos colectores comunes a los que van aplicados los conductos de abastecimiento y distribución del mencionado fluido, presentando una configuración dichos colecro4s que determinan la existencia de una zona o cámara de aire separadora de ambas placas mientras que en la cara opuesta a las mismas dispone de una aleta superior, de sección en U, para su acoplamiento a la estructura del edificio y una pestaña inferior que soporta un bloque de material aislante situado bajo la segunda plaza dela que esta separada mediante una lámina microaislante cuya cara enfrentada con la placa posee poder reflexivo para evitar perdida de energía, pudiéndose unir varios módulos así formados por medio el encastre en los costados de las placas superiores de una pieza adicional de características elásticas adecuadas permitiendo la unión de dos módulos consecutivos en un mismo plano o formando ángulo en el caso concreto de su utilización como cumbrera.
